Output 26942589a5dc41f59294790216ca582d4c4d1e33a6fdf19acd326213ace49f98:25

value
12062460
script pubkey
OP_0 OP_PUSHBYTES_20 7a53cc4f7999649bb03c9118a4fced735503d69b
address
bc1q0ffucnmen9jfhvpujyv2fl8dwd2s845mw55mxy
transaction
26942589a5dc41f59294790216ca582d4c4d1e33a6fdf19acd326213ace49f98
spent
true